The BCD section has become consumed with discussion about BP/W's. It is to the point that you can't get advice on non BP/W questions there anymore. Any request for information about non-BP/W BCDs is met with 10 responses of "you should get a BP/W."

Most of the non-BP/W users have quit posting in that forum due to the beating that they take when they mention anything but a BP/W. While the BP/W may be a great option for some, the majority of divers out there are not in BP/W setups and still need advice there as well.

My suggestion is to split this forum.

How about subsections like:

Traditional BCDs (Jacket/Back-inflate)
Backplates & Wings

That way posters interested in each could inquire and receive non combative discussions on each type of platform. I believe this would also bring more traditional BCD owners back to the forum for discussions who may otherwise be reluctant to post these days due to the current bias.
 
I have to agree that it gets old fast to feel talked down to by the BP/W crowd. There isn't any thought to the possibility that some people LIKE big pockets, an air cell that wraps around them (and sometimes makes them feel secure), integrated weight pockets, and very simple donning.

I have a good friend who wouldn't think of ever giving up her SeaQuest Diva LX with all it's bulkiness. She practically turned pale when she saw my Zeagle Zena and it's minimalist design. My husband also wouldn't give up his SeaQuest Pro QD Plus for 100 BP/W set-ups. He loves being able to stash his camera (and everything else on the boat) in his pockets, and doesn't find it hard to dive in.

Neither of these folks are wrong, they just want something different than a BP/W and there are a lot of folks out there like them.
 
For the record, no one disputes that the problem is real. This is agreed.

At issue is the best way of solving not only this specific problem, but others exactly like it except that the topic might be pony bottles, PADI, use of spare airs, etc.

Splitting forums is one answer. More aggressive and focused moderation is another answer. Sticky Instructions regarding having OPs clearly indicate whether or not they ONLY desire input from one camp or the other (and self-policing) is yet a third option.

But the point is that whichever answer you implement may not only impact the BCD forum, but may potentially impact other similar forums on ScubaBoard.

Take this discussion off of "Jacket BC versus BP/Wing" specifically, and elevate it up to a level that looks at what is best for all similar forums on the board.

At a board-wide level I agree with Andy, Walter, Lamont, TSandM, and others that splitting this forum isn't the optimal answer. A combination of clearly stating the topic of a thread and aggressive moderation achieves the same objective without any restructuring of forums... IMHO.

As one who has been in jacket BCs and recently switched to a BP/W but can still the benefits of both, I would hate to see the categories split up as is being debated here:

How would it fundamentally stop the problem? By banishing people for mentioning a BP/W on the jacket forum? I don't believe that splitting would do much for the root issue.

Does SB have to be split into subforums every time a debate comes up on passionate subjects? What's next, splitting the exposure protection into drysuit/wetsuit? It seems that people are frequently jumping in and saying "get a drysuit" whenever anyone asks about cold water wetsuit options - do we have to shuttle them into their own little subforum instead? How about non-split versus split fins? Same problem. Same in the regulator forums whenever someone inquires about an integrated alternate air source - should that be split into subforums as well?

I think the best suggestion made previously was to implore the BP/W advocates to be a bit more self-policing. I would rather see that tried as an answer first before carving up the forum further. If it works, great, if not then alternatives could be tried. But don't jump to a more extreme solution as the first defense.
